Trip Overview

The drive from Hudson, NH to Enfield, NH covers 91.7 miles and takes about 1h 59m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.

The route leans on I 89, Everett Turnpike, Dartmouth College Highway for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is highway-focused dr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 53.8 miles on I 89. At current regular gas prices, budget about $14.76 one way before food or hotel costs.

Drive Character

This is a 1h 59m highway drive covering 91.7 miles, with most of the trip on I 89 and Everett Turnpike. The longest continuous stretch is about 53.8 miles on I 89.

Most of the miles stay on highways, which makes pacing and fuel planning easier than turn-by-turn city driving.
There are about 23 navigation steps in the underlying route data, so the final approach matters more than the middle miles.
I 89 is the longest continuous segment at about 53.8 miles.
